Vodka Sauce

Cultural Context

Vodka sauce is a popular Italian-American dish that combines the richness of cream with the acidity of tomatoes, creating a unique flavor profile. It is often served with pasta, particularly penne, and has become a staple in many Italian restaurants across the United States. The dish is believed to have originated in the 1980s and has since gained widespread popularity for its creamy texture and savory taste.

Servings4
2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
1/2 average sized onion
2 cloves garlic
1/2 te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es
3 ounces tomato paste
3 ounces heavy cream
1 ounce vodka
1 ounce freshly grated Parmesan cheese
pasta of choice
pasta cooking water
optional: 4 ounces diced pancetta
optional: 2 teaspoons crushed Calabrian chilies
optional: 8 ounces tomato puree
optional: 1/2 ounce Pecorino Romano cheese
optional: fresh herbs (basil or parsley)

1

Bring a wide shallow pot of heavily salted water to a boil.

2

Finely dice half an average sized onion and peel two cloves of garlic.

3

Heat 2 tablespoons of extra virgin olive oil in a large sauté pan until shimmering.

4

Add the diced onion and cook for 3 to 4 minutes until translucent.

5

Crush in the 2 cloves of garlic and sauté for about 30 seconds until fragrant.

6

Add 1/2 teaspoon of crushed red pepper flakes and 3 ounces of tomato paste, cooking for about 2 minutes until the tomato paste darkens in color.

7

Lower the heat and add 3 ounces of heavy cream and 1 ounce of vodka, stirring together and cooking for no more than 1 minute to prevent the alcohol from cooking off.

8

Once the pasta is about a minute shy of your preferred doneness, transfer it directly into the sauté pan to finish cooking in the sauce.

9

Adjust the heat as necessary and add reserved pasta cooking water, a quarter cup at a time, to make the sauce smooth and glossy, cooking for no more than another minute.

10

Kill the heat and immediately add 1 ounce of freshly grated Parmesan cheese, stirring off the heat and adjusting the thickness with pasta water if necessary.

11

Plate the pasta and optionally top with extra grated Parmesan.
